High-Powered Vacuum Extraction
Using truck-mounted extraction units, technicians pull out allergens from your HVAC network. These tools create negative air pressure that contains contaminants into a sealed debris container. Unlike basic vacuums, this professional technique delivers complete removal of toxic debris.

Rotating Brush Cleaning
To remove compact mold, technicians use flexible agitation tools inserted into your ventilation pipes. These tools scrub contaminants from the duct lining, making them simple to extract. This vital step ensures complete sanitization of your air distribution system.
HVAC Surface Disinfection
After physical debris removal, a antimicrobial sanitizer is applied throughout your HVAC system. This eliminates bacteria that remain after cleaning. The treatment offers continuous purification. HVAC disinfection is particularly important for post-renovation spaces.

Costs and Support in AB
Typical Rate in Bankview
Homeowners in AB can expect between CAD $300–$600 for a professional ducted system purge job. Costs vary on system complexity, but cost-effective solutions are accessible.
- Single homes: from $275–$375
- Mid-size homes: standard $400–$550
- Custom homes: $550–$700+ featuring extra sanitization
- Commercial systems: billed per square footage

Track Household Humidity
High dampness in your residence creates the optimal conditions for fungus. Regulating indoor moisture between ideal levels prevents musty odors after duct sanitization.
Install hygrometers in bathrooms, and circulate your interior frequently—especially after laundry—to protect your investment.
